Address 0 PPC

PPRKyk3ay97XWALwhrzUmySMfawtYZ6WqW

Confirmed

Total Received32.591733 PPC
Total Sent32.591733 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PRKyk3ay97XWALwhrzUmySMfawtYZ6WqW32.591733 PPC
Fee: 0.01 PPC
532228 Confirmations32.581733 PPC
PPRKyk3ay97XWALwhrzUmySMfawtYZ6WqW32.591733 PPC
PBmqEBmN8cMat5X7Vtxndh8KMBigJaZNNV112.5729 PPC
Fee: 0.01 PPC
532243 Confirmations145.164633 PPC